Tim Duncan Is Empowering Tony Parker

Tony Parker is on fire to start this game, scoring 17 points and dishing out five assists in the first nine minutes, but his performance also illustrates why Tim Duncan is great. While Parker is playing well, it’s Duncan’s screens that are getting him open, and it’s Duncan’s confidence in his own jumper that is not only giving Parker assists, but also keeping the offense flowing.

Duncan’s hesitation has been a major issue in this series thus far, as it’s allowed the Oklahoma City Thunder to load up their defense and cut off driving lanes. In this game, though, Duncan is making quick decisions, beating the Thunder to their spots. That must continue for the San Antonio Spurs to win.

If it does, Parker should continue having a big game.
